Grout is a dense fluid that serves to fill gaps and reinforce existing structures. It typically consists of a mixture of water, cement, and sand, and is commonly used to seal joints, such as the gaps between tiles. When building a wall or floor, the elements are placed onto an adhesive backing with gaps left between them.
